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Wat Khao Rang Samakkhitham.
- Visit early in the morning to avoid crowds and enjoy the peaceful atmosphere.
- Dress modestly as a sign of respect when visiting the temple.
- Bring a camera to capture the stunning views from the temple's elevated location.
- Take your time to explore the intricate details of the temple's architecture and surrounding gardens.
- Try to visit during a local festival for a unique cultural experience.

Getting There
-
Tuk-Tuk
From your current location in Phuket, find a nearby tuk-tuk stand or flag down a passing tuk-tuk. Tell the driver 'Wat Khao Rang Samakkhitham' or show them the address: '87 7 Ratsada, Mueang Phuket District, Phuket 83000'. The driver will take you directly to the temple. It's approximately a 15-20 minute ride depending on traffic.
-
Songthaew
Locate a songthaew (shared taxi) route that goes towards Ratsada. Get on the songthaew and ask the driver to drop you off at 'Wat Khao Rang Samakkhitham'. The fare is usually around 30-50 THB. You may need to walk a short distance from the drop-off point to reach the temple.
-
Walking
If you are staying nearby, you can walk to Wat Khao Rang Samakkhitham. Head towards Ratsada and look for signs directing you to the temple. The temple is situated on a hill, so be prepared for a bit of an uphill walk. Follow Ratsada Road until you reach the entrance, which is marked with signs.
-
Motorbike Taxi
Look for a motorbike taxi stand or ask your hotel to arrange one for you. Tell the driver 'Wat Khao Rang Samakkhitham' or show them the address. This is a quick option, and you'll reach your destination in about 10 minutes, depending on traffic. Ensure you wear a helmet for safety.
